Show Information

Bond Park is the perfect outdoor setting for this classic Shakespearean romantic comedy, served straight up with a spicy twist of Bollywood! Frolic with Oberon (the King of the Fairies) in the shimmering enchanted woods, with impish Puck, Bottom, and "the stuff that dreams are made of..."! Remember, "the course of true love never did run smooth" and "Lord, what fools these mortals be!" when they get lost in the wood and mix it up with some meddling fairies. This 21st Cary Players production was directed by Nancy Rich.

Location and Dates Were

October 2-4, 2009 and 8-10, 2009 at 7:30pm
At Bond Park's Sertoma Amphitheater (801 High House Road in Cary)
